    Abstract

    The subject of invention is a device (1) for opening bags, in particular bags containing loose materials, consisting of sharp-pointed elements (6) mounted in at least one row and fixed on at least one profile (5), characterized in that the sharp-pointed elements (6) are shaped like an arrowhead and the ends of at least one profile (5) are in which they are embedded are attached to the perimeter of the lower frame (2) of the device (1), with a movable frame (3) placed above the lower frame (2), movably connected to the lower frame (2) by means of pins placed at the corners of the frames (2, 3) and a locking mechanism (4), and containing at least one profile (7) with a hole adapted to the dimensions of the sharp-pointed elements (6) and positioned over the profile (5) with the sharp-pointed elements (6), the device (1) further comprises handles (9) attached to the lower frame (2).

    [0045] FIG. 1 shows a device 1 according to the invention which consists of two square-shaped frames parallel to each other: a lower frame 2 and a movable frame 3 connected by pins placed in the corners of the frames. A locking mechanism is mounted between the lower frame 2 and the movable frame 3, which in the embodiment of the device according to the invention is in the form of four springs 4 placed at the corners of the frames 2, 3. The pins between the frames (not shown) are located inside the springs 4. Two profiles 5 are fastened perpendicularly to each other on the lower frame 2 in such a way that their ends are fixed on the circumference of the lower frame 2, which is also shown in FIG. 2.

    [0046] The profiles 5 have sharp-pointed elements 6 (shown in FIG. 2) in the shape of an arrowhead, the elements being arranged alternatelywith a larger arrowhead angle and a smaller arrowhead angle. On the movable frame 3, profiles are mounted with holes 7 adjusted to the dimensions of pointed elements 6 and placed over the profiles 5 with sharp-pointed elements 6. Between the profiles with holes 7 and the perimeter of the mobile frame 3, reinforcing ribs 8 are fixed.

    [0047] On the lower frame 3, on opposite sides, handles 9 are mounted, enabling the device according to the invention to be mounted on size-adapted containers or to be mounted on a support mechanism. On the underside of the lower frame 3, support members 10 are attached.

    [0048] FIG. 3 shows an example of a device 1 according to the invention in which a bumper 11 is mounted on the lower frame 2. The bumper is in the form of a section which at one end is attached to the lower frame 2 while the other end comprises a bracket 111. The bracket 111 in the illustrated embodiment is in the form of a rectangular profile. In another embodiment, the longer sides of the support 111 may be bent towards the device according to the inventionthis facilitates the stabilization of the bag to be opened at the height of the frames of the device 1. The height of the bumper 11 is adjusted in such a way that when it is folded, the bracket 111 is on the movable frame 3. The buffer 11 may comprise a damping element in the form of a rubber element or a spring.

    [0049] The bumper, at the height of the movable frame, folds, and after foldingas shown in FIG. 4its upper part is placed on the movable frame 3, which additionally secures against uncontrolled pressure on the movable frame 3 and the protrusion of sharp-pointed elements 6 when the device does not is used.

    [0050] FIG. 5 shows a device according to the invention with a support mechanism 12. The support mechanism 12 comprises struts 121 with holes for length adjustment which struts 121 are slidably positioned in the toothed rack 122. The connection of the struts 121 and the toothed rack 122 as well as the length adjustment is possible by means of pins 123.

    [0051] The toothed racks 122 make it possible to adjust the length of the support mechanism 12 depending on the width of the container on which the device according to the invention is to be placed. The struts 121 are connected to the handles 124 of the support mechanism 12. The handles 124 comprise profiled connectors 125 of the handle 124 with struts 121, which connectors include pin-lockable holes which allow the height of the struts 121 on which the device of the invention is mounted to be adjusted.

    [0052] Both the handles 9 of the device according to the invention and the handles 124 of the support mechanism can comprise hooks (91; 1241) to facilitate mounting the device according to the invention to the container by means of ropes or chains.

    [0053] FIGS. 6 and 7 show an embodiment of the invention in the form of a bag-opening device with a folding blocking member 13 attached to the lower frame 2. FIG. 6 shows the situation in which the folding blocking member 13 is in a closed form and the operation of the device according to the invention is possible, while FIG. 7 shows a situation in which the foldable locking element 13 is unfolded and one of its parts blocks the movement of the movable frame 3.
